11 Controlling Line (A sentence with a B/M/E)
The top scaring monster realises that scaring is bad, so risks all to do the right thing. A lonely robot falls in love when he is visited by a robot from space and he travels to find her. A young boy, whose parents are murdered by the Empire, discovers his Jedi powers and uses them to defeat the empire’s base. A man discovers that reality is simulated and enters the real world to join the resistance and becomes the One

12 Stage 1: Equilibrium Who is your protagonist?
What are there passions and fears? Establish time and location.

13 Stage 2: Disequilibrium
Protagonist’s fears are realised. Protagonist’s passions are challenged. What is your disruptive event or person? Establish enigma.

14 Stage 3: Recognition What action does your protagonist take to re-establish equilibrium?

15 Stage 4: Repair What are progressive complications that are overcome?
What are there passions challenged further? Climax

16 Stage 5: Restoration Return to equilibrium.
How has the protagonist changed? What is the moral or lesson?
